The detailed description of these two votes is much more than I would expect to see in a general article about a person. This is a person who was national Vice Chair for two terms, and all that the article tells us about what he did during that time is that some LNC members tried to removed him twice and failed! And in trying to explain those votes it cites the opinions of LNC members on a variety of topics, in a way that has already led to disputes about how much "opinion" should be included. But opinion was the essence of the dispute, and expanding the account to explain the reasons more completely, or to include additional nuances of the criticism, or the opinions of additional LNC members, would make these paragraphs even longer. The only way somebody is going to fully understand these events is by going back to the source documents -- things like the minutes of LNC meetings and the posts by Vohra that triggered the criticism. And even with respect to LNC action on these matters, this account is incomplete! A quick review of the minutes of the February 2018 meeting shows that after the vote to suspend failed another vote, to censure him, passed. Leaving that out I think presents a misleading impression that the LNC did nothing. IF this whole matter is important enough to be documented in this way (beyond what is already available in minutes and so on), it should be done in a more balanced and complete way -- which will take more space than is appropriate here. My suggestion, then, is that this whole thing be moved to a separate article where the matter can be better explained, and with detailed references/citations included. That will also allow much more flexibility to structure the account, with separate paragraphs or subsections, to be able to include multiple, possibly conflicting, viewpoints of the various people involved.
